Generate server code with swagger editor
Next, use mvn swagger2cxf:generate command to generate the server stub This practical guide for using the Swagger Editor will get you writing API in no time.
#Generate server code with swagger editor how to
$/src/main/resources/s.ymlĪlso add the following maven build helper plugin Learn how to write your own OpenAPI definitions in the Swagger Editor.
To generate a war with tomac naming convention use maven-war-plugin with the following.Īdd the following plugin to generate server stub for CXF. There are certain dependencies to be added to the POM file. I'm on Ubuntu and using Maven to run the Spring-boot server. I generate the code with Swagger codegen 2.0 and 3.0, and with the tool integrated in the Swagger Editor, but it return the same thing. Next step is to create a maven project and add the created swagger specification yaml file to the resources folder. But when I try to generate the code I got this : I got the same problem when I try to add any example (in //definitions/ for example). The Swagger Codegen allows generation of both client libraries and server stubs from a Swagger definition.įirst step is to generate swagger API specification using swagger editor. Swagger is a 100% open source REST framework which helps companies like Apigee, Getty Images, Intuit, LivingSocial, McKesson, Microsoft, Morningstar, and PayPal build the best possible services with RESTful APIs. The two main advantages of swagger are interactive documentation and client SDK generation. Swagger is a simple and powerful representation of your REST API.Thousands of developers are supporting Swagger in almost every modern programming language and deployment environment.